Job Description

Position title : Mission Command Fundamentals (MCF) Course Director

Location : Stennis Space Center, Mississippi

Clearance required : SECRET

Responsibilities include (but are not limited to):
  • Act as the lead for providing course content and ensuring continuity across all iterations of the Mission Command Fundamentals Course (MCFC).
  • Oversee the planning and execution of up to two MCFC iterations per fiscal year.
  • Lead the design, development, and delivery of all course curriculum documents in accordance with NAVEDTRA 130 series standards, including the Training Project Plan (TPP), Lesson Plans (LPs), and Trainee Guides (TGs).
  • Identify, vet, and coordinate with up to 12 content speakers, subject matter experts, and academics for each course to ensure instruction remains relevant and impactful.
  • Manage the development and execution of the multi-day capstone exercise, to include scenarios based on Humanitarian Assistance/Disaster Relief (HA/DR), civilian-military maritime incidents, and military-military hostile acts.
  • Manage contractor personnel and the day-to-day conduct of the course in accordance with the lesson plan and course schedule.
  • Develop, prepare, and provide all necessary course materials for students and instructors.
  • Author and submit a comprehensive After-Action Report (AAR) to the government following the completion of each course iteration.
  • Serve as the primary Subject Matter Expert (SME) for the annual course review to provide recommendations for curriculum updates and improvements.


Qualifications

  • Must possess extensive experience in curriculum development and management in accordance with Navy Educational Training (NAVEDTRA) standards.
  • Proven experience leading, managing, and instructing in a formal training environment, preferably with senior international military students (O-3 to O-6).
  • Deep, demonstrable understanding of Mission Command philosophy, Joint/Combined Operational Planning, the Military Decision-Making Process (MDMP), and the Operational Level of War.
  • Demonstrated ability to manage contractor personnel, course schedules, and curriculum development timelines effectively.
  • Excellent written and oral communication skills, with the ability to professionally engage with guest speakers, stakeholders, and senior military leaders.
